Job Overview
-Being both the company's and clients key site contact and ensuring the CP teams strive for and exceed the expectations for service excellence to be achieved through proactive management and leadership. Maintaining a clear focus together with the provision of key management information and site.
-Develop and maintain key stakeholder site relationships with the clients
-Ensure the operation runs in accordance with the approved SOP documents as laid down by the client and Mitie.
-Ensure the operational team delivers the service in line with the published KPI standards
-Ensure all statutory training and vetting requirements applicable to the contract are carried out and recorded in line with the contract requirements.
Main Duties
-Main duties
-Ensure the service delivery is completed to the KPI standards and exceptions or risks are notified in advance where possible.
-Attend and participate in key site stakeholder meetings.
-Ensure full compliance with safe working practices and reporting.
-Ensure accurate and timely completion of any and all incident reports.
-Allocation of tasks to Operatives on a daily/weekly basis liaising to ensure we maximise the use of Mitie staff instead of using Contractors by filling the tasks within the time limit set by Parliament
-Maintain accurate records and tracker data for all aspects of the operation.
-Communicate effectively with company external support teams to ensure the one team approach is practiced and promoted.
-Ensure all staff engaged carry the correct level of screening and CTC / SC clearance. All CTC / SC cancelations must be actioned immediately, and staff removed from the contract if they fail to comply.
-Ensure compliance with all Mitie and site Health and safety policies and procedures.
-Ensure all statutory training has been conducted and recorded for CP Officers.
-Manage and ensure compliance with the WP+ payroll and annual leave systems.
-Ensure the full employment cycle of recruitment, onboarding, induction, Job specific training and the notification of leavers are completed and documented in accordance with company procedures.
-Conduct Site Visits to monitor the employee's / contractors to ensure we are delivering a good service whilst maintaining high standards
-Recruitment of Close Protection Officers within my Area of responsibilities
-Coach and develop your team in all aspects of their role.
-Ensure full site staff engagement by holding regular team briefing meetings and toolbox talks.
-Create a positive site culture between the Mitie team and all key stakeholders.
-Maintain an accurate record of all Mitie owned assets.
-Ensure all HR processes are conducted in accordance with Mitie policies and procedures.
-Aspire to be an ambassador for Mitie at all times.
What we are looking for
-Person Specification
-Must hold a SIA Close protection Licence
-Must be able to work from the Shard 3 days a week
-Can demonstrate Knowledge and understanding of Health, Safety Environmental and quality systems and the management of SSOW associated with the contract.
-Able to represent Mitie at key stakeholder meetings
-Able to demonstrate key leadership skills
-Has good commercial and general management skills
-Ability to demonstrate and maintain excellent client facing focus
-Has the ability to work calmly whilst under pressure
